Do you still get nutrients from lactose-free milk?

2 min read

According to the National Institutes of Health, an estimated 65% of the world's population has a reduced ability to digest lactose after infancy. Many of these individuals turn to lactose-free dairy products, but a common question arises: do you still get nutrients from lactose-free milk? The answer is a resounding yes, as the milk is processed to be easily digestible while maintaining its nutritional integrity.

Understanding Lactose-Free Milk Production

Lactose-free milk is regular milk treated with the enzyme lactase, which breaks down lactose into more easily digestible sugars, glucose and galactose. This process doesn't alter the milk's protein, fat, or nutrient content, allowing those with lactose intolerance to benefit from dairy without digestive discomfort. Switching to lactose-free milk provides the same nutritional benefits as regular milk and can be used interchangeably in cooking and baking.

The Nutritional Equivalence to Regular Milk

Lactose-free and regular milk share nearly identical nutritional profiles because the lactase enzyme addition doesn't remove vital nutrients. This distinguishes it from dairy-free alternatives like almond or soy milk, which have different nutritional compositions. Lactose-free milk may taste slightly sweeter due to the broken-down sugars.

Key Nutrients Found in Lactose-Free Milk

  • Calcium: Essential for strong bones and teeth.
  • Vitamin D: Aids calcium absorption and supports the immune system; many lactose-free milks are fortified with it.
  • Protein: Crucial for muscle and tissue repair and growth.
  • Phosphorus: Supports bone health alongside calcium.
  • Vitamin B12 and Riboflavin: Important for energy and nerve function.

Lactose-Free vs. Plant-Based Alternatives

Lactose-free dairy is distinct from plant-based milks like almond or soy, which are naturally lactose-free but have different nutrient levels, often lower in protein and calcium unless fortified.

Nutrient Lactose-Free Cow's Milk Almond Milk (Unsweetened) Soy Milk (Fortified)
Protein High (Approx. 8g per cup) Very low (Approx. 1g per cup) Moderate (Approx. 7g per cup)
Calcium High (Comparable to regular milk) Often fortified, but lower bioavailability Fortified, but with potentially lower bioavailability than cow's milk
Fat Varies by type (whole, 2%, etc.) Low Low
Vitamins (D, B12) Present, often fortified Levels vary, often fortified Levels vary, often fortified
Lactose Negligible amount (<0.01%) None None

Lactose-free milk is the most nutritionally similar substitute for cow's milk if avoiding lactose. It's important to note it's not suitable for those with a dairy allergy (to milk proteins).
